Abstract

The project proposes the identification, classification and description of the impact marks generated by stone (ballistae) and dart throwers(scorpions or Roman catapults) present in large numbers on the northern section of the walls that connect Porta Vesuvio and Porta Ercolano, legacy of the Silla shoots (89 BC). The project will employ photogrammetric models and inverse modelling of the ballistic footprints to determine the mechanical properties of the wall’s materials. Once the density, the shape and volume of the thrown balls are known, it will be possible to calculate the impact kinetic energy and the initial throwing speed. The mechanical characterization will make the origin of the impact craters and the traces of rust generated by the tips of darts embedded in it clear to legible to visitors. It is the ambition of the proponents to adapt the canons of experimental archaeology to certify prototypes based on a digital organization of the sources. The same will serve as a reference for identifying new finds and verifying the originality of what is around on the web. A thematic platform will be able to provide adequate support for the production, storage and management process of data according to a systemic approach for a complete integration of knowledge in 3D galleries, that will attract an enlarged audience of users and the involvement of citizens, including people with disabilities. The multimodal and cross-media interest will fall on the social and economic development not only of the Campania region in which the Cultural Heritage insists. The dedicated platform will spread the culture of the imperial era by identifying the roots of European culture in line with the priorities set by the European Council.
